Henry Robin Joins North Sea Capital

Henry Robin has joined North Sea Capital as a senior partner, and head of the Denmark-based firm’s New York office. He previously was a partner with AlpInvest.

Here is Robin’s bio, from the North Sea Capital website:

Henry Robin joined the team in 2009 to head North Sea Capital’s office in New York. He is a United States national and has over twenty years’ experience in investment management, the last seventeen of which have been in private equity portfolio management. Previously he was a founding partner of AlpInvest Partner’s New York office and he has also held senior positions at Credit Suisse First Boston and the MacArthur Foundation. He serves on the Advisory Boards of Acon-Bastion Partners II, EQT Opportunity and Sovereign Capital II.

He holds a B.S. and a M.M. from Northwestern University and was named an F.C. Austin Scholar at the J.L. Kellogg Graduate School of Management. He is also a Chartered Financial Analyst.
